You are never fully dressed without a smile

Coastal Currents Festival looks set to build on last year's success as it opens in style at Alexandra Park this Friday. The launch sees author Iain Sinclair address the crowds, artist installations in the park, and a turn from the ever popular Bohemia Ukulele Trio.
Also set to return are Back Door Gallery who present 'You Are Never Fully Dressed Without A Smile', a performance by artists Smalls-Murray. When pressed on what to expect performance co-conspirator Luke Murray was characteristically elusive, simply revealing that there will be 'suits, smiles, and murder, but not necessarily in that order'. Fear not though, as the artists later reassured that any murder involving participating audience members will be on a purely metaphoric level.
The launch opens Friday 27 August, 6-9pm, at Eat@ the park & Bandstand area in Alexandra Park. Don't miss out on what promises to be a truly unique event and get down to support one of the most exciting festivals around.
